“If a thief tells you to go to court, just know that his brother is the judge”- Former President, Goodluck Jonathan

Former President Goodluck Jonathan, has decried the level of decadence in some government institutions and the new culture of asking their critics to go to court when they are called out for doing something perceived to be wrong.

While speaking at a public event recently, the former President stated that when a ‘’thief” asks you to go to court, it invariably means that the judge who is to rule on the matter is most likely their brother and would certainly rule in their favor.

‘’“We see government institutions doing the wrong thing and telling people to go to court. There is this saying in East Africa that if a thief tells you to go to court, he knows that brother is the judge.” he said
